Scott Danesi is a multi-talented pinball industry figure who serves as the designer, programmer, and composer for the pinball game Total Nuclear Annihilation. Beyond his work on this game, he creates music and sound design for various pinball projects and arcade games like Step Maniacs. Danesi is also an active competitive pinball player who streams gameplay and participates in the pinball community.

Scott Danesi spent 2 years developing TNA as a personal garage project before Spooky Pinball picked it up for production
Scott Danesi designed the TNA playfield, wrote all custom code, and composed the entire synthwave soundtrack himself

Final Resistance's cannon fires balls back at players in rapid succession, representing a mechanical feature never done before in pinball
The playfield was designed specifically to win over P3 skeptics by playing like a traditional pinball machine with minimal LCD integration
Final Resistance music will be released as limited edition cassette and vinyl, following the TNA music release model
Final Resistance features a large alien ship on the back right of the playfield with a shield that blocks shots and must be moved to access lock shots

Scott Danesi designs entire pinball machines in 3D SolidWorks rather than starting with 2D drawings
The horseshoe lock was the first major playfield element Scott Danesi added after flippers in Rick and Morty design
Scott Danesi intentionally included the MagnaSave as a negotiating tool to potentially remove during cost discussions
The bumper had to be fixed via code adjustment during playtesting because it was initially too weak to make meaningful shots
Rick and Morty greenlight decision was made at Southern Pride Game Room Expo around 2017
Scott Danesi designed the horseshoe locking mechanism for Rick and Morty during TNA production, before greenlight
Scott Danesi uses SolidWorks to design playfields iteratively: print blank layouts, hand-draw, build 3D elements, reprint and redraw repeatedly
MagnaSave was added late in development as a negotiating tool for cost reduction but was retained due to executive positive feedback
Rick and Morty's MagnaSave implementation uses bouncing/pulsing effect rather than ball-holding, making it more skill-based than traditional implementations
The Rick and Morty pop bumper was weak initially in code, then fixed to create better shot-making, which Scott identifies as most satisfying feature

Atari renewed the Total Annihilation trademark in February 2017
TNA uses Python programming language with Skeleton Game Framework for code implementation
The girl in the back glass artwork is modeled after Scott Danesi's wife
Matt Andrews created the entire TNA back glass artwork in Adobe Illustrator
Steve Ritchie initially complained the left scoop ejection speed was too fast but later approved the design
TNA music album was released on iTunes, Spotify, Google Play, and cassette formats
Scott Danesi unknowingly included a red button Easter egg homage to Pat Lawler's design tradition
Python was chosen for TNA code because its syntax is simple and accessible, reducing cognitive load for designers
Total Nuclear Annihilation uses Python programming language for game code, which Scott Danesi highlighted for its readability
